> I am trying to install my first ;-( Android application into a Samsung
> tab phone device but it does not start; i wonder if i am missig
> something in the process:
>
> 1- Appl needs a pre-existing sqlite database, which i have installed
> (eclipse+DDS+pull) into my development environment ... so, it is
> installed under data/data/MYAPPL/databases/myDB.db
>
> 2- the appl runs fine into the emulator
>
> 3- i have conected my phone device, start adb and have seen my device:
> ./adb kill-server
> ./adb start-server
> ./adb devices
>
> 4- i have installed (with sucess) my apk:
> ./adb install -l workspace/myAppl.apk
>
> DOES THE APK FILE INCLUDES THE DB ?

Not based on anything you have described here. You manually copied the
database to the device in step #1. That does not put the database
inside of the APK file, any more than copying a file to a Windows PC
automatically puts it inside an .MSI file.

> 5- disconnect my device:
> ./adb kill-server
> + unpluged
>
> BUT, THE APPLICATION DOES NOT START:
>  ... "application has stopped unexpectedly ..."
>
> I think the problem is related with the database; maybe it does not
> exist, but i am tryin to see waths going on ... may somebody help me ?

Use adb logcat, DDMS, or the DDMS perspective in Eclipse to examine
LogCat and look at the stack trace associated with your error message.
